it's pedal to the steel for driverless motors



whilst a may additionally 2016 crash killed the man or woman working a Tesla version S driving in Autopilot mode, advocates of self sufficient cars feared a slowdown in improvement of self-using vehicles.

instead the other has took place. In August, Ford publicly dedicated to field self-driving motors through 2021. In September, Uber started choosing up passengers with self-using automobiles in Pittsburgh, albeit with protection drivers prepared to take over.

October saw Tesla itself undeterred via the fatality. The company began producing cars it stated had all the hardware needed for autonomous operation; the software program can be written and brought later. In December, days after Michigan hooked up regulations for trying out self sufficient motors in December, fashionable vehicles started doing simply that with self-riding Chevy Bolts. And just in the future before the end of his term, U.S. Secretary of Transportation Anthony Foxx special 10 research facilities as legit take a look at web sites for automated car structures.

3 of the maximum considerable traits inside the enterprise passed off earlier this month. The 2017 client Electronics show (CES) in Las Vegas and the North American worldwide car show in Detroit noticed automakers new and antique (and their providers) display off their plans and innovations on this arena. And the countrywide Transportation protection Board (NTSB) issued its file at the Tesla fatality. together, they advocate a destiny full of driverless automobiles that are each more secure than present day automobiles and considerably exclusive in appearance and comfort.

confirmation of protection

The NTSB report contained a key finding as a way to no doubt further fuel the self sustaining car motion. past locating no protection disorder in the Tesla car, or even other than its selection not to reserve a keep in mind of the car, the professional authorities file declared that self sustaining motors are safer than human-pushed ones.

To make its locating, the company analyzed records Tesla collects remotely from all its vehicles. It as compared the range of times airbags deployed in Tesla cars which have Autopilot and earlier fashions with out it. it's one manner of determining how many serious injuries the cars had been worried in.

The facts revealed that the twist of fate charge was tons decrease in Tesla automobiles geared up with Autopilot. motors with Autopilot had airbags set up as soon as in each 1.3 million miles of driving; the ones without Autopilot deployed their airbags as soon as each 800,000 miles. (The NTSB recommended that Tesla's Autopilot calls for the full attention of the driving force, and cited that driving force inattention contributed to the fatal crash.) satirically, the Tesla coincidence, tragic although it become, might also in the end increase self assurance in autonomous car technologies, way to the NTSB research.

manufacturers be a part of the fray

the ones safer vehicles of the future will no longer all be Teslas, although. at the same time as Google's seven-12 months-long effort to broaden an autonomous automobile has hit a few bumps, CES well-knownshows from fundamental existing car corporations confirmed strong development.

Audi, BMW, Chrysler, Ford, GM, Honda, Hyundai, Nissan and Toyota all highlighted their efforts to seize up with upstart Tesla. some of these conventional automobile corporations displayed radical thoughts, which include retractable steering wheels, scissor doors and on-board AI assistants like Amazon's Alexa.

industry providers are also joining the sport. car parts giant Delphi verified a self-driving Audi square SUV on the streets of Las Vegas, the end result of a partnership with collision detection innovator Mobileye. And French dealer Navya showed off an all-electric powered self-driving minibus.

New trends rise up

a brand new player on the scene is microprocessor innovator NVIDIA, whose images processing devices are a good deal higher at handling huge amounts of statistics speedy than conventional laptop chips have been. The enterprise has evolved extremely energy-efficient processors which can be supporting deep getting to know for autonomous riding on an Audi Q7. Deep mastering lets in the car to analyze from examples and from revel in, improving its overall performance in various situations over the years. these systems can support drivers who are in my opinion working their cars: for instance, noticing the driver is looking to the left and may not see a bike owner drawing near at the proper. Tesla is already the usage of NVIDIA supercomputers in its cars, and Mercedes is operating on integrating NVIDIA artificial intelligence into its merchandise.

similarly, sensor technology are each getting higher and some distance greater cost-efficient. that is true most significantly of LIDAR, a laser-based sensing technique broadly utilized in driverless cars.
